<< NEW YORK (AP) -- Angering civil libertarians who fear ``1984''-style
tactics,
 Police Commissioner Howard Safir is suggesting that police take a DNA sample
 along with the fingerprints of everyone arrested.

 ``The innocent have nothing to fear,'' Safir said Monday. ``Only if you are
 guilty should you worry about DNA testing.'' >>
